will和would的区别和用法

will和would的区别和用法

Will和Would的区别与用法

在英语中,“will”和“would”是两个常用的情态动词,它们在表达意愿、习惯、请求以及虚拟语气等方面有不同的用途。以下是关于这两个词的详细区别和用法:

一、基本含义

  1. Will

    • 表示将来的动作或状态。
    • 表达个人的意愿、决心或承诺。
    • 用于构成一般将来时。
  2. Would

    • 是“will”的过去式,但在某些语境下,它并不直接表示过去的时间概念。
    • 常用于表达过去的习惯、倾向或经常性的行为(但现在可能不再如此)。
    • 在条件句中表示与现在或将来的事实相反的假设情况(即虚拟语气)。
    • 用于礼貌地提出请求或建议。

二、具体用法

  1. 表示将来的动作或状态

    • Will: 我明天将去旅行。(表示未来的计划)
      • I will go on a trip tomorrow.
    • Would(在此情况下不常用,通常会用“will”的替代形式来表达):
      • 注意:虽然理论上可以说“I would go on a trip tomorrow if...”,但这通常是在某种条件或假设下的说法,而不是直接表示未来。
  2. 表达个人意愿

    • Will: 我愿意帮你。(表达现在的意愿)
      • I will help you.
    • Would(更委婉):你愿意帮我吗?(询问对方的意愿)
      • Would you like to help me?
  3. 表示过去的习惯

    • Would: 他以前常常早起。(描述过去的经常性行为)
      • He would get up early in the morning.
  4. 虚拟语气

    • Would: 如果我有时间,我会去的。(表示与现在事实相反的情况)
      • If I had time, I would go.
    • Would have done: 我本来会告诉你的,但我忘了。(表示与过去事实相反的情况)
      • I would have told you, but I forgot.
  5. 礼貌的请求或建议

    • Would: 你愿意和我一起去看电影吗?(礼貌地邀请)
      • Would you like to go to the movies with me?

三、总结

  • “Will”主要用于表示将来的动作、状态和个人的直接意愿。
  • “Would”则更多地用于表示过去的习惯、礼貌的请求或建议以及在虚拟语气中表达与事实相反的情况。

通过理解这些区别和用法,你可以更准确地在不同的语境中使用“will”和“would”。